241-Law School Instruction Position Summary The Villanova Graduate Tax program seeks qualified individuals for its Adjunct Faculty Pool and welcomes applicants who have an interest in teaching courses in taxation. The Graduate Tax Program offers programs leading to a Masters of Laws in Taxation (LL.M.) and a Master in Taxation (MT). Villanova is a Catholic university sponsored by the Augustinian Order. The University is an equal opportunity employer and seeks candidates who understand, respect and can contribute to the University's mission and values. Duties and Responsibilities Teaching graduate tax courses. Duties will vary with the specific courses being taught. Minimum Qualifications An LLM, JD, and/or Master's degree in a related discipline is required; Must be committed to excellence in graduate tax education. Preferred Qualifications Previous teaching experience preferred. Special Message to Applicants All applicants must apply online and must include: a letter of interest, including a description of your teaching philosophy, and the name and email address for at least 3 references. current curriculum vitae. academic transcripts; unofficial transcripts will be accepted to submit application; however, official transcripts are required if you are selected for an interview. Screening of submitted applications begins when a teaching vacancy arises. Salary Posting Information This adjunct position has a salary of $1,600.00 per credit hour. This may be pro-rated in the case of team-teaching scenarios where effort is shared.
